WORKPLACE RELATIONS REGULATIONS 2006 (SLI NO 52 OF 2006) - REG 2.19.52

Withdrawal of infringement notice

         (1)   Before the end of 28 days after receiving the infringement notice, the recipient may apply, in writing, to the nominated person for the infringement notice to be withdrawn.

         (2)   Within 14 days after receiving the application, the nominated person must:

                (a)    withdraw or refuse to withdraw the notice; and

               (b)    notify the recipient in writing of the decision and, if the decision is a refusal, the reasons for the decision.

         (3)   If the nominated person has not approved, or refused to approve, the withdrawal of the notice within the period allowed by subregulation (2), the application is taken to have been refused.

         (4)   A workplace inspector may also withdraw an infringement notice issued by him or her without an application having been made.
